About Robert J. Dempsey
Robert J. Dempsey is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Neurology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Epidemiology, having authored 278 papers that have together received 16.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cerebrovascular and Carotid Artery Diseases (47 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(37 papers), Cardiovascular Health and Disease Prevention (28 papers),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(24 papers), Global Health and Surgery (24 papers),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(21 papers), Acute Ischemic Stroke Management (20 papers) and Neurogenesis and neuroplasticity mechanisms (19 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Developmental Neuroscience (1.2k citations), Neurology (2.1k citations), Neurology (2.5k cit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(4.9k citations) and Genetics (1.6k citations). Robert J. Dempsey has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Türkiye and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Phillip A. Tibbs, Byron Young, Raghu Vemuganti, Richard J. Kryscio, William R. Markesbery, Roy A. Patchell, James F. Hatcher, Kellie K. Bowen, Aclan Dog⫧an and Vemuganti L. Raghavendra Rao. Their work appears in journals such as Neurosurgery, Journal of neurosurgery, Journal of Neurochemistry, Brain Research and Neurological Research.
